Fishes and dolphins-same organs and similar general shape
How can fact which fishes and dolphins have same organs and similar general shape be explained?
Expert
Fishes and dolphins have same organs and shape since though they have phylogenetically distant ancestors they face same environmental pressures because they share the similar habitat (water). So by undergoing genetic variability and natural selection a number of similar features, for illustration, the hydrodynamic body and the presence of fins, were in-corporate in these animals.
